A reading from the Acts of the Apostles.

0:09.8

In those days, some Jews from Antioch and Iconium arrived and won over the crowds.

0:16.7

They stoned Paul and dragged him out of the city, supposing that he was dead.

0:22.4

But when the disciples gathered around him, he got up and entered the city.

0:27.6

On the following day, he left with Barnabas for Derby.

0:31.5

After they had proclaimed the good news to that city, and made a considerable number of disciples, they returned to

0:39.9

Leistra and to Iconium and to Antioch. They strengthened the spirits of the disciples and

0:46.9

exhorted them to persevere in the faith, saying, it is necessary for us to undergo many

0:53.4

hardships to enter the kingdom of God.

0:56.5

They appointed presbyters for them in each church, and with prayer and fasting,

1:02.4

commended them to the Lord in whom they had put their faith. Then they traveled through Pisidia

1:09.2

and reached Pamphylia. After proclaiming the word at

1:13.7

Perga, they went down to Atalia. From there they sailed to Antioch, where they had been commended

1:21.8

to the grace of God for the work they had now accomplished. And when they arrived, they called the church together

1:30.3

and reported what God had done with them

1:33.3

and how he had opened the door of faith to the Gentiles.

1:37.3

Then they spent no little time with the disciples.
